Engine Block Heater: Service and Repair

Removal





1. Drain the engine cooling system.
2. Disconnect the (A) block heater wire extension from the (B) block heater wiring and remove.

3. WARNING: The electrical power to the air suspension system must be shut off prior to hoisting, jacking or towing an air suspension vehicle. This can be accomplished by turning off the air suspension switch located in the RH kick panel area. Failure to do so may result in unexpected inflation or deflation of the air springs which may result in shifting of the vehicle during these operations. Failure to follow these instructions may result in personal injury.

Raise and support the vehicle.





4. Disconnect the (A) block heater wiring from the (B) block heater.





5. Remove the block heater.

1 CAUTION: Do not loosen the screw more than necessary for removal.

Loosen the screw.
2 Twist and slide the block heater to release the retainer clip and remove. Discard the retainer clip.

Installation





1. Note: To ease installation, coat the block heater sea] and the cylinder block hole with Premium Long Life Grease XG-1-C or equivalent meeting Ford specification ESA-M1C75-13.

Note: If equipped with air suspension, reactivate the system by turning on the air suspension switch.

Lower the vehicle.

To install, reverse the removal procedure.
